The Pros and Cons of RFID Scanning Technology
Radio Frequency Identification (RFID) technology is an innovative and powerful tool for businesses looking to track their assets and inventory. RFID scanning technology uses radio waves to identify and track objects, allowing businesses to gain real-time visibility into their inventory, streamline operations, and reduce costs. In this article, we’ll explore the pros and cons of RFID scanning technology, including its benefits and limitations, so you can determine if it’s the right solution for your business needs.
Pros of RFID Scanning Technology
- Real-Time Inventory Tracking: RFID scanning technology allows businesses to track their inventory in real-time, providing accurate and up-to-date information about the location, status, and movement of their assets. This can help businesses streamline their supply chain management processes and reduce the time and labour required to manage inventory.
- Increased Efficiency: RFID scanning technology can help businesses improve efficiency by automating inventory tracking and reducing manual labour. This can save time and money while also reducing errors and inaccuracies that can occur with manual tracking methods.
- Better Asset Management: RFID scanning technology allows businesses to track their assets and equipment more accurately, which can help reduce loss and theft. This can also help businesses optimise asset utilisation and maintenance, reducing downtime and increasing productivity.
- Enhanced Customer Experience: RFID scanning technology can help businesses provide a better customer experience by improving inventory accuracy and reducing out-of-stock situations. This can help businesses ensure that products are available when customers need them, improving customer satisfaction and loyalty.
Cons of RFID Scanning Technology
- High Initial Costs: RFID scanning technology can be more expensive than other tracking methods, such as barcode scanning. The cost of RFID devices, RFID warehouse, and RFID chip cost can add up quickly, making it difficult for smaller businesses to justify the investment.
- Limited Read Range: RFID scanning technology has a limited read range compared to other tracking methods, which can make it difficult to track assets and inventory in large facilities or outdoor environments.
- Interference and Signal Loss: RFID scanning technology can be affected by interference and signal loss, which can cause inaccurate readings and data loss. This can be particularly problematic in areas with high electromagnetic interference or metal objects, such as warehouses or manufacturing facilities.
- Security Concerns: RFID scanning technology can be vulnerable to hacking and data breaches, which can compromise sensitive information and put businesses at risk. It’s important for businesses to implement proper security measures, such as encryption and access controls, to protect their data.
Conclusion
RFID scanning technology offers many benefits for businesses, including real-time inventory tracking, increased efficiency, better asset management, and enhanced customer experience. However, there are also limitations and potential drawbacks to consider, including high initial costs, limited read range, interference and signal loss, and security concerns. Ultimately, the decision to implement RFID scanning technology depends on your business needs and budget. If you have a large facility, deal with a lot of inventory, and need to track assets in real-time, RFID scanner technology may be the right solution for you.
But if you have a smaller operation, barcode scanning or other tracking methods may be more cost-effective and efficient.
